An example of nucleophilic substitution is the hydrolysis of an alkyl bromide, R-Br under basic conditions, where the attacking nucleophile is hydroxyl (OH −) and the leaving group is bromide (Br −). + + Nucleophilic substitution reactions are common in organic chemistry.
Following the addition elimination mechanism first a nucleophilic NH 2 − is added while a hydride (H −) is leaving. The reaction formally is a nucleophilic substitution of hydrogen S N H. Amine alkylation (amino-dehalogenation) is a type of organic reaction between an alkyl halide and ammonia or an amine. [1] The reaction is called nucleophilic aliphatic substitution (of the halide), and the reaction product is a higher substituted amine. A second type of transamination reaction can be described as a nucleophilic substitution of one amine or amide anion on an amine or ammonium salt. [1] For example, the attack of a primary amine by a primary amide anion can be used to prepare secondary amines: RNH 2 + R'NH − → RR'NH + NH 2 −
Nitrenoids can be generated from O-alkylhydroxylamines containing an N−H bond via deprotonation or from O-alkyloximes via nucleophilic addition. These intermediates react with carbanions to give substituted amines. Other electron-deficient, sp 3 amination reagents react by similar mechanisms to give substitution products. [3]

The von Braun reaction is an organic reaction in which a tertiary amine reacts with cyanogen bromide to an organocyanamide. [1] An example is the reaction of N,N-dimethyl-1-naphthylamine: [2] These days, most chemist have replaced cyanogen bromide reagent with chloroethyl chloroformate reagent instead.
